A major traffic collision occurred today on Bennett Valley Road in Santa Rosa, CA, involving a black Nissan Titan and possibly another unidentified vehicle. The incident was reported around 7:01 PM, prompting a swift response from emergency services.
Emergency personnel arrived on the scene to find a 30-year-old male trapped inside the Nissan Titan, sustaining unknown injuries. Firefighters and medical teams worked diligently to extricate the individual while ensuring the safety of the surrounding area. A tow truck was requested to assist with the removal of the vehicle, which resulted in temporary lane closures on Bennett Valley Road.
As the situation developed, the incident was classified as a traffic collision with major injuries, highlighting the seriousness of the circumstances. The roadway remained impacted for a significant period as responders managed the scene and assessed the situation.
Motorists are advised to avoid the area and seek alternative routes while emergency crews worked to clear the scene. The full extent of injuries to the victim has not been disclosed, and further updates will be provided as more information becomes available.
